Output 29cf86185138229ff838677f6c7067e5328ec2b92841c8a9805d108342a8e729:1

value
21532824
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68d996bfbced95755337d8512da1f0be7f2bc736 OP_EQUAL
address
MHTZAihgubR8xDhjgrfN1iZwjWkSLKZwfv
transaction
29cf86185138229ff838677f6c7067e5328ec2b92841c8a9805d108342a8e729
spent
true